Eliminar PrecompiledViews.dll de ASP.Net Core 2 API
En la aplicación de API web .NET Core 2, la función Publicar en carpeta en MS VS 2017 produce:
<ProjectAssembly>.PrecompiledViews.dll
<ProjectAssembly>.PrecompiledViews.pdb
Documentos oficiales dice queVistas precompiladas relacionado conprecompiling Razor Views
, pero mi API no contiene vistas ni archivos estáticos, solo puntos finales REST que devuelven json.
Usando .Net reflector encontré el PrecompiledViews.dllvacío.
Entonces borréPrecompiledViews.dll
y probé mi API y parece funcionar bien sin advertencias ni excepciones.
¿Es seguro eliminar PrecompiledViews.dll y pdp si la API no utiliza ninguna vista de afeitar? En caso afirmativo, ¿hay alguna opción en VS 2017 para dejar de publicar PrecompiledViews no utilizados?